About Guidewire
Guidewire is one of the leading cloud-based software solutions for Property & Casualty (P&C) insurance. Guidewire helps insurance companies manage their core business operations, including:
- Policy Management
- Claims Management
- Billing
- Customer Management and Engagement
- Data Analytics
- Insurance Cloud Services
Guidewire InsuranceSuite includes the following products:
- PolicyCenter
- ClaimCenter
- BillingCenter
Guidewire is used by many innovative insurers to replace legacy systems with a scalable and configurable insurance platform.

Guidewire Products You Must Learn
1. Guidewire PolicyCenter
PolicyCenter helps with:
- Policy Management
- Policy Renewals
- Underwriting
- Policy Administration
- Risk Management
2. Guidewire ClaimCenter
ClaimCenter helps with:
- Claim Management
- Claim Investigation
- Claim Payment
- Claim Recoveries
- Fraud Detection
- Claim Settlement
3. Guidewire BillingCenter
BillingCenter helps with:
- Billing Management
- Payments
- Commissions
- Billing Operations

What programming language is used in Guidewire?
Gosu is the primary programming language used in Guidewire, along with Java, XML, SQL, REST APIs, and SOAP-based integrations.
